Crisis in Ukraine: the United States seizes the UN Security Council

The US ambassador to the UN calls for a public meeting of the Security Council on Monday.

The United States announced on Thursday 27 January in a press release (in English) requesting a public meeting on Monday of the UN Security Council on the crisis around Ukraine. “More than 100,000 Russian troops are deployed on the Ukrainian border and Russia is engaging in other acts of destabilization targeting Ukraine, which constitutes a clear threat to international peace and security and the Charter of the United Nations”, says in this press release the American ambassador to the UN, Linda Thomas-Greenfield.

“This is not a time to wait and see”, argues Linda Thomas-Greenfield. “Members of the Security Council must look squarely at the facts and consider what is at stake for Ukraine, for Russia, for Europe and for the fundamental obligations and principles of the international order, should Russia invade more Ukraine.”
